I've been studying the POH of the PA-34 and I have a question regarding the engines.

It's said to be a Continental (L)TSIO-360E. If I'm not wrong the "L" applies for left; the "T", for turbocharged; the "I", for injected; the "O", for opposed; but... What does "S" apply for?

TS is joined together...TurboSupercharged.
A good design, quite reliable.
